Former Chelsea player Craig Burley has claimed that Jurgen Klopp has already told new signing Xherdan Shaqiri that he will not be playing every week.

Shaqiri signed for Liverpool from Stoke City and became our third signing of the summer and Burley was adamant that the Swiss star was explained what his role in the team would be.

The former Chelsea man was quoted by the Express as saying:

“There’s no way Klopp sold this to him in a one-to-one meeting as ‘you’re going to play every week’”

Burley added that Klopp would not lie to the player about his position and then risk losing him later on during the season. He also added that while Shaqiri would not start too many games for us, there would be a number of competitions where he would be playing, such as the Champions League.

“But it’s a squad game, Champions League, all the cup competitions.”

Shaqiri completed a £13million move from the Potters on Friday and part of why his deal was so cheap was because Stoke had to deal with relegation last season.

Burley is probably right, as Klopp would not sign someone and not give him a proper role. However, there still is some hope for Shaqiri as we have seen our manager give a run out to players should some first-team player not do well.

We have seen it with Andy Robertson getting a go last season along with Joe Gomez and Trent Alexander-Arnold too. If Shaqiri proves his worth on the training pitch, he will have a major role to play this season.
